Player Overview
Don Jason Warner is a poker player from the United States, currently ranked 20,772nd in the world, with career earnings totaling $157,958. He has demonstrated solid performance in multiple events, particularly excelling in Texas Hold'em.
Career and Notable Achievements
Warner has repeatedly reached final tables in regional poker events, including WSOP side events and online series. His best result is a victory in a small to medium-sized tournament, with the exact year and prize not publicly disclosed. He has also achieved significant earnings in cash games.
Playing Style
Warner's style leans towards solid play, emphasizing starting hand selection and positional advantage from late position. He excels at post-flop hand reading and using math to pressure opponents, but is somewhat conservative in aggression, often adopting a strategy of waiting for good opportunities.
